The Association Centro Tutela e Ricerca Fauna Esotica e Selvatica Monte Adone (hereinafter Association) is located in the Province of Bologna, Italy. It is a non‐profit organization, with legal personality, registered in the Volunteer Register of the Emilia Romagna Region. The main purpose of the association is to safeguard local and exotic fauna and operates in agreement with the Emilia Romagna Region for rescue and management of native species, and with the Ministry of Environment for recovering and providing long term care for exotic species.
The Centro Tutela e Ricerca Fauna Esotica e Selvatica Monte Adone was founded in 1989 as a Wildlife Rescue Centre in response to emerging of many problems related to native fauna due to increasing human activity in our area and to a lack of administrative protection. The continued recovery of injured animals, made necessary the creation of an emergency unit for the native fauna of the Italian Apennines that would provide the care, rehabilitation and reintroduction of animals in their natural habitat. In November of the same year, unexpectedly, with the arrival of the first lion cub used by a “beach photographer” we started, first in Italy, the activity of recovering of animals originating from other countries, imported illegally for profit, fun, entertainment and exploitation.
In time the Wildlife Rescue Center became a stable reference point for citizens, public authorities, the police and the fire brigade, and in December 1993 the founders, Rudi Berti, his family with a small group of dedicated volunteers founded the Association Centro Tutela e Ricerca Fauna Esotica e Selvatica Monte Adone”.
The Centre is committed to recovering and rescuing wounded autochthonous wild animals (deer, raptors, hedgehogs, foxes, dormice, etc). The emergency rescue service operates 24/7 on the territory of Emilia Romagna Region. The rescued animals are provided with veterinary treatment, care and rehabilitation to facilitate the reintroduction in the wild. Moreover, the Center guarantees a continuous information and support service for public authorities, law enforcement agencies and departments, as well as citizens that could deal daily with problems and difficulties concerning wild animals. One of the most important projects of the Association is the “Wolf project”, started in 2012, that aims to supply the treatment and rehabilitation of rescued wolves. The “Wolf Project, Monte Adone”’s goal is to manage a specialized center in rescuing, medical treatment, rehabilitation and final reintroduction of wolves in the wild. The project includes also the post release monitoring and educational activities.
The Centre assists the rescue and the protection of abandoned or abused exotic fauna which often includes animals proceeded from mistreatment, unauthorised trade and possession (felines, primates, parrots, etc.). Whenever practicable these animals are introduced into specific projects within the EU where they can live in appropriate social groups for the species and in semi-free environment. For others, as well as for the rescued local fauna for which the release is not possible, the Centre becomes a permanent home. Nowadays, among the exotic animals, the Center is a sanctuary for 6 chimpanzees, 2 tigers, 4 lions and 11 monkeys.
Besides animal rescue and care, an important part of our work consists in the education and sensibilisation of the general public towards the environmental issues (guided visits, school lectures, conferences etc.). Moreover, the Center collaborates with Universities regarding animal behaviour researches.
The environmental education and awareness rising is organized on two levels:
1. Didactic/educational implemented through the “School project” (for school children and environmental educators).
2. Enhancing environmental awareness of citizens (for adults and families) primarily through the guided visits but also with organization of public events.
